About L E Scudder

L E Scudder is a scholar working on Hematology,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Genetics,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Immunology and Allergy, having authored 26 papers that have together received 2.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Platelet Disorders and Treatments (18 papers), Blood Coagulation and Thrombosis Mechanisms (11 papers), Antiplatelet Therapy and Cardiovascular Diseases (7 papers), Cell Adhesion Molecules Research (5 papers), Coagulation, Bradykinin, Polyphosphates, and Angioedema (5 papers), Blood properties and coagulation (4 papers),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(4 papers) and Blood groups and transfusion (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Hematology (1.1k citations), Internal Medicine (259 citations), Immunology and Allergy (366 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(770 citations) and Surgery (608 citations). L E Scudder has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Switzerland and Italy. Frequent co-authors include Barry S. Coller, Christopher A. Sullivan, Ellinor I.B. Peerschke, Robert E. Jordan, John D. Folts, Susan R. Smith, Dimitrios Α. Tsakiris, Daniel G. Lang, Herman K. Gold and Tameshwar Ammar.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Investigation, Thrombosis and Haemostasis, Circulation,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Blood.
